Are you asking for Delhi University? As per the eligibility If you are a graduate in Economics from a college in DU, you can get a direct admission provided you have performed well academically in your graduation. If you are unable to get a direct entry, are not a DU graduate or don’t have a degree in Economics, you can sit for the entrance exam that is open to all graduates.
